Russian grain export ban comes into force

According to a decree signed by Mr Putin, the ban will be in place until the end of the year, although it may be extended beyond that date if harvest is bad.
The drought amid the worst ever heatwave in Russia’s history has ruined one quarter of the country’s crops.
The authorities yesterday reported success in reducing fires burning close to its main nuclear research centre in Sarov.
But the acrid smell returned to Moscow as shifting winds brought back smog from the Ryazan and Vladimir regions where three major peat bogs were burning.
